Under Armour Announces New Top Management: Shadman as CLO, Baxter as Americas President

Under Armour is undergoing changes in its top management. John Stanton, the Chief Legal Officer, is retiring at the end of 2022. Meanwhile, Stephanie Pugliese, President of the Americas, is leaving the company after three years in the role. The sportswear giant has announced new appointments to fill these positions.

Stanton's departure comes after nine years of service at Under Armour. He will be succeeded by Mehri Shadman, a nine-year veteran currently serving as Deputy General Counsel, Corporate and Risk, and Assistant Corporate Secretary. Shadman will take up the new role effective October 24, 2022.

Pugliese's exit follows the recent departure of CEO Patrik Frisk in June 2022. She will stay until early 2023 to help with the transition. David Baxter, the current Senior Vice President of Americas Wholesale, will take over as President of the Americas, effective October 24, 2022. Baxter previously served as CEO of Lids Sports Group. Under Armour has thanked Pugliese for her leadership during a challenging retail environment and will offer her severance benefits, including insurance coverage for 18 months and a lump sum of one and a half times her annual base salary.
